Position Summary

The Account Associate is a key member of the Account Management team, providing support to the Account Director and Account Managers. The primary responsibility of the position is to provide customer account-focused support to assist in the achievement of annual sales. The Account Associate is responsible for alignment with the customer account team, managing the relationship with distributors and customer account systems administration to ensure the smooth operation of the team.

Key Responsibilities

Trade Auditing/Analysis (Deductions, Fines, Claims, Post-Audit Work) (40% of Role)

  • Support the Account Management Team and Sales Finance leader with trade deduction analysis and reconciliation.

Management of Customer post-audit claims

  • Collaborate with Account Managers and Sales Finance Revenue Growth Management in responding to and managing undisputed claims, and lead status management of existing disputed claims.
  • Participate in customer meetings to resolve claims with third party vendors

Deduction Workflow Administrative Management

  • Help research and resolve deduction issues and engage in follow up meeting with claims that need further investigation.
  • Develop in depth understanding and management of post audits and deductions that impact the business & customer in allowing the company to drive profitable business results.
  • Drive collections of unauthorized deductions and application credits from the customer

Support Customer Metric Forecasting

  • Manage off invoice and input of planning tools
  • Ensure off invoice trade events align with customer systems
  • Tie out customer forecast to Nestle internal forecast
  • Trade & deduction management & new item setup + reconciliation

Post Audit Disputes

  • Manage all external systems and ensure 100% post-audit response
  • Collection of unauthorized deductions/deducted post audits
  • Meeting support for external customer specific system meetings
